Engine oil and filter
1. Place a large drain pan under the drain plug
k
1
.
2. Remove the oil filler cap.
3. Remove the drain plug with a wrench and
completely drain the oil.
CAUTION
Be careful not to burn yourself, as the
engine oil is hot.
¼ Waste oil must be disposed of properly.
¼ Check your local regulations.
4. Loosen the oil filter with an oil filter wrench
k
2
. Remove the oil filter by turning it by hand.
5. Wipe the engine oil filter mounting surface
with a clean rag.
Be sure to remove any old rubber gas-
ket remaining on the mounting surface
of the engine.
6. Coat the gasket on the new filter with clean
engine oil.
7. Screw in the oil filter clockwise until a slight
resistance is felt, then tighten additionally
more than 2/3 turn.
Oil filter tightening torque:
11 to 15 ft-lb
(14.7 to 20.5 Nm)
8. Clean and re-install the drain plug and a new
washer. Securely tighten the drain plug with a
wrench.
Drain plug tightening torque:
22 to 29 ft-lb
(29 to 39 Nm)
Do not use excessive force.
9. Refill engine with recommended oil and in-
stall the cap securely.
